Trust fund for asbestos victims claims

An asbestos trust fund may be for you if you are an asbestos victim. These trust funds were set by the companies that manufacture asbestos-based products. They are intended to help you receive compensation for the pain and losses you have suffered. They can be difficult to navigate, so it's recommended to consult with a reputable mesothelioma attorney to help you make a successful claim.

The amount you get will depend on the fund you make your claim with. However, a knowledgeable mesothelioma lawyer can find a fund that is suitable for your needs. You could be eligible for compensation if your trust has an approved job website.

There are two main ways to get compensation from an asbestos trust: filing a lawsuit against responsible businesses, or by claiming through the asbestos trust fund. Asbestos trusts pay only an amount of a tiny portion of the value of your claim every calendar year. You should file your claim earlier than later.

Getting a claim approved isn't an easy process, therefore it's essential to have all the documentation to justify your claim. This could include a doctor's note of your diagnosis and medical records as well as employment records. It's also recommended to get an attorney's opinion as to whether you're eligible to be trust funds.

Generally, the money you get from an asbestos trust isn't taxed. There are some exceptions to this rule. A mesothelioma lawyer who is reputable can determine if your case is qualified for an asbestos trust fund.
